Maybe I don't understand but is this it?
kk1 <- list(a_c = union(kk$a, kk$c), b = kk$b)
kk1
$a_c
[1] 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11
$b
[1] 6 7 8 9 10

I have a list like
kk<- list (a = 1:5, b = 6:10, c = 4:11)
Now i want to merger (Union) the list element "a" and "c" by name .
My expected outcome is
kk1<- list(a_c = 1:11, b = 6:10)
I can do it with several lines of code. But can any one have idea to do
efficiently/ quickly on a big data with less code.
